And if you're looking to stock up on some frozen meals to help get you through the week, you'll find a ton of starter ideas below. All of these meals:
• Keep the focus on most (or all) whole foods. The fewer ingredients listed —especially ones you can't pronounce — the better.
• Opt for little-to-no added sugar, and less than 800 mg of sodium.
